Taxonomic Classification

Rank Ecuadoran Pericote Moth
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Cricetidae Tineidae
Genus Phyllotis Lindera
Species Phyllotis haggardi Lindera tessellatella

Evolutionary Relationship

Ecuadoran Pericote and Moth share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
